I'm finally working on putting my Iron Man Modular Armor together. I'm trying to solve my biggest hang up on my project.

I'm trying to find a way to hook things like the shoulders to the torso with something other than nylon webbing clasps like you see on life jackets. I don't trust glue just holding the webbing to the plastic.

Has anyone tried these screws used for leatherworking? I was considering heating them into the plastic, the using a leather strap to hold pieces together.

I don't know. Just a thought. Just trying to find the most durable way possible to attach everything .

I have used chicago screws for attaching stuff to leather which are the same thing basically but are flat on both sides. They work great for semi permanent applications but would be a royal PITA on something that isn't going to stay together during transport or storage.

#

I have had good luck using a combination of buckles, magnetic purse clasps, and velcro on my WIP mk85.

Threaded inserts can be nice if you have somethjng that you may be taking on and off. But like zombie is saying unless you planned to use threaded inserts in the first place and your part has enough material to actually hold the insert in then you can't really use them.

#

Also for armor you wouldn't be screwing on shoulders or other pieces of the armor when you go to wear it. You want it that you can relatively easily put it on and take it off whether it be by yourself or if you need help. Alot of people will just make a harness with straps and buckles and then you have buckles attached to the inside of your armor pieces to attach to the harness.

I bought heavy duty button snap pieces and 3d printed these little square pieces with a hole in the middle. Half of the button snap pieces would go into the printed square, the other half would go into the strap. Then I would hot glue the square piece with half the button snap to the part and then weld it the part with a soldering iron. It holds much better than just glueing the straps to the parts.
